The primary factors for 70 is 2 x 5 x 7. In other words, 70 can be expressed as a product of its prime elements that are 2, 5, and 7.
Expressing 70 as a result of its prime factors 2, 5, and 7 is known as prime decomposition of 70. These prime factors
are the fundamental components that compose the number 70.
